Скриптинг курилка

Quote:
Originally Posted by GreenS
Посмотреть сообщение
Ячейка, в смысле, в MySQL или в моде?
в моде
Quote:
Originally Posted by GreenS
Посмотреть сообщение
Можно ли сделать, чтобы insert into происходил к свободной строке (`id`)?
нет, а раз у вас появилась такая идея, рекомендую вам никогда больше не подходить к MySQL пока вы не прочитайте всю документацию!
Reply

есть у кого нибудь массив всех максимальных скоростей транспорта? где то видел тут было
Reply

Quote:
Originally Posted by Jon_De
Посмотреть сообщение
есть у кого нибудь массив всех максимальных скоростей транспорта? где то видел тут было
Невозможно замерить точное, можно взять максимальное для всех.
Взять за основу самый быстрый автомобиль и спустится с самого крутого спуска на полной скорости.
Reply

Quote:
Originally Posted by Fill
Посмотреть сообщение
Невозможно замерить точное, можно взять максимальное для всех.
Взять за основу самый быстрый автомобиль и спустится с самого крутого спуска на полной скорости.
сколько максимум разгоняет авто по прямой, если так понятнее будет
смысл брать максимальное? допустим инф едет около 140 миль, спидхаком можно ехать на мопеде тоже 140 будет?
Reply

А ещё не забывай про мотоциклетный внутриигровой баг с распределением массы.
Reply

Quote:
Originally Posted by Mutha_X
Посмотреть сообщение
А ещё не забывай про мотоциклетный внутриигровой баг с распределением массы.
Разгон по пингу с напарником. т.е. я подрезаю по пингу и нас ускоряет Правда краткосрочно, так как это столкновение и кого-то развернёт.
Reply

Quote:
Originally Posted by Jon_De
Посмотреть сообщение
сколько максимум разгоняет авто по прямой, если так понятнее будет
смысл брать максимальное? допустим инф едет около 140 миль, спидхаком можно ехать на мопеде тоже 140 будет?
Дело в том, что так или иначе придётся брать грубое значение потому что на скорость влияют разные факторы.
Если если речь идёт о гет велосити, машине может дать ускорение другая машина и она может поехать быстрее обычного.
Reply

Quote:
Originally Posted by Fill
Посмотреть сообщение
Дело в том, что так или иначе придётся брать грубое значение потому что на скорость влияют разные факторы.
Если если речь идёт о гет велосити, машине может дать ускорение другая машина и она может поехать быстрее обычного.
пусть едет, мне это не будет мешать
Reply

Quote:
Originally Posted by Jon_De
Посмотреть сообщение
пусть едет, мне это не будет мешать
Конечно если ты кикать не собрался.
Reply

Quote:
Originally Posted by Fill
Посмотреть сообщение
Конечно если ты кикать не собрался.
собрался

дак что, есть у кого массив скоростей?
Reply

Эх... Добавили бы функцию изменения физических параметров авто(handlings) было бы вообще шикарно
Reply

Quote:
Originally Posted by Stepashka
Посмотреть сообщение
вот варианты в зависимости от того где ты это используешь
pawn Код:
public SomePublic() {
    static a = 10;
    switch(random(a--)){
        case 0:{ }
        case 1:{ }
        case 2:{ }
        case 3:{ }
    }
}
}
А разве не будет такого. Что 1 игроку произошло действие из случайного case 3 то ведь case 10 уже ведь не будет входить в данный код, но по прежнему может использовать case 3.
Reply

Кто-то, кажется, искал
PHP код:
new FloatMaxVehicleSpeed[212] = 
    {
        
160.00160.00200.00120.00150.00165.00110.00170.00110.00180.00160.00,
        
240.00160.00160.00140.00230.00155.00200.00150.00160.00180.00180.00,
        
165.00145.00170.00200.00200.00170.00170.00200.00190.00130.0080.000,
        
180.00200.00120.00160.00160.00160.00160.00160.0075.000150.00150.00,
        
110.00165.00190.00200.00190.00150.00120.00240.00190.00190.00190.00,
        
140.00160.00160.00165.00160.00200.00190.00260.00190.0075.00075.000,
        
160.00160.00190.00200.00170.00160.00190.00190.00160.00160.00200.00,
        
200.00150.00165.00200.00120.00150.00120.00190.00160.00100.00200.00,
        
200.00170.00170.00160.00160.00190.00220.00170.00200.00200.00140.00,
        
140.00160.0075.000260.00260.00160.00260.00230.00165.00140.00120.00,
        
140.00200.00200.00200.00120.00120.00165.00165.00160.00340.00340.00,
        
190.00190.00190.00110.00160.00160.00160.00170.00160.0060.00070.000,
        
140.00200.00160.00160.00160.00110.00110.00150.00160.00230.00160.00,
        
165.00260.00160.00160.00160.00200.00160.00160.00165.00160.00200.00,
        
170.00180.00110.00110.00200.00200.00200.00200.00200.00200.0075.000,
        
200.00160.00160.00170.00110.00110.0090.00060.000110.0060.000160.00,
        
160.00200.00110.00160.00165.00190.00160.00170.00120.00165.00260.00,
        
200.00140.00200.00260.00120.00200.00200.0060.000190.00200.00200.00,
        
200.00160.00165.00110.00200.00200.00260.00260.00160.00160.00160.00,
        
140.00160.00260.00
    
}; 
Reply

Quote:
Originally Posted by Xotab
Посмотреть сообщение
Эх... Добавили бы функцию изменения физических параметров авто(handlings) было бы вообще шикарно
Еще лучше - для каждого автомобиля индивидуально.
Reply

Разобрался.
Reply

Как проверить что данные содержащиеся в строке являются числом, чистым числом без символов?
Reply

Quote:
Originally Posted by Urukhay
Посмотреть сообщение
Как проверить что данные содержащиеся в строке являются числом, чистым числом без символов?
числа есть символы, так что ваше предложение противоречиво.
pawn Код:
if (strval(string)) //строка
else //не строка
Не идеально но проще всего, будет определять строки типа "546545апывоапыаорвпаы аывпва" как числа, для 100% определения тебе нужны или регулярки либо проверять каждый символ.
Reply

Как это TextDrawShowForPlayer(playerid, Player[Player[playerid][gSpectateID]][Spec]);:
pawn Код:
for(new i = 0; i < MAX_PLAYERS; i++){
    if(i == Player[playerid][gSpectateID]){
        TextDrawShowForPlayer(playerid, Player[Player[playerid][gSpectateID]][Spec]);
    } else TextDrawHideForPlayer(playerid, Player[i][Spec]);
}
воспроизвести в PlayerTextDrawShow

pawn Код:
if(i == Player[playerid][gSpectateID]){
    PlayerTextDrawShow(playerid, Spec);
} else PlayerTextDrawHide(playerid, Spec);
Reply

Как правильно создавать TextDrawCreate для каждого игрока в OnGameModeInit?
Reply

Quote:
Originally Posted by Nikid
Посмотреть сообщение
Как правильно создавать TextDrawCreate для каждого игрока в OnGameModeInit?
Для игрока наверное лучше создавать в OnPlayerConnect, используя функцию CreatePlayerTextDraw.
Reply


Forum Jump:


Users browsing this thread: 12 Guest(s)